Key Responsibilities & Duties
- Create, format, and edit documents including reports, memos, and presentations using word processing software.
- Transcribe and revise handwritten materials and tapes to produce accurate legal documents.
- Ensure adherence to company guidelines and templates in document formatting.
- Proofread documents for grammar, punctuation, and spelling accuracy.
- Collaborate with colleagues to gather necessary information for document creation.
- Manage document versions, revisions, and comparisons (redlines).
- Convert documents between formats and troubleshoot formatting issues.
- Assist in the preparation and distribution of finalized documents.
- Create and update tables, charts, and graphics within documents.
